Health Promotion and Prevention

is a vital field that focuses on preventing disease and promoting overall well-being. This undergraduate certificate program is designed for individuals who wish to make a difference in the lives of others by creating healthy environments and communities.

Through this program, learners will gain a solid understanding of the principles and practices of health promotion and prevention, including epidemiology, health education, and policy development.

Some of the key topics covered in the program include:


Health Equity, Behavioral Change, and Community-Based Interventions.

By completing this certificate program, learners will be equipped with the knowledge and skills necessary to design and implement effective health promotion and prevention strategies.

Course Content

• Epidemiology of Chronic Diseases
• Health Psychology and Behaviour Change
• Nutrition and Dietetics for Health Promotion
• Health Education and Communication
• Biostatistics and Research Methods
• Environmental Health and Sustainability
• Global Health Issues and Inequities
• Health Promotion Policy and Advocacy
• Health Economics and Resource Management
• Health Informatics and Data Analysis

Assessment

The evaluation process is conducted through the submission of assignments, and there are no written examinations involved.
